Abstract:

A reconfigurable DC-DC converter that provides both step-down and step-up functions is proposed to ensure a stable output voltage over full voltage range of battery in portable devices. The converter can automatically adjust itself into different modes, so as to enhance system efficiency. Moreover, seamless transition is achieved to reduce output ripple and improve line regulation. Additionally, a novel current-sensing technique is applied to realize lossless and accurate current sensing. The controller IC is designed and fabricated in 1.5-um BCD process. Test results verified the design target.
